Hamilton Wood Type and Printing Museum

The Hamilton Wood Type and Printing Museum was founded in 1999 and is located in , , United States. The museum is run by the Two Rivers Historical Society.

House
The Bernard and Fern Schwartz House, also known as Still Bend, is a Usonian-style house at 3425 Adams Street, next to the , in , United States. is situated 1½ miles north of Hamilton Wood Type and Printing Museum.
